International Journal of Rotating Machinery Electric Machine with Low Cost or High Reliability Electric machines have been widely adopted by a variety of applications, including electric/hybrid electric vehicles, wind power generators, more electric aircrafts, industrial drives, and automations, etc. Currently, various topologies of electric machines have been proposed and novel topologies are emerging. Although the electric machines with permanent magnet offer high torque density, power density and high efficiency. However, due to the relatively high cost and the limited resource of rare-earth magnets, less or no rare-earth magnet machines are desirable. Such machines include hybrid-excited, wound field-excited, and PM-assisted synchronous reluctance machines, etc., which are currently being developed for various applications with new topologies. Meanwhile, reliability is another key issue which needs to be concerned. The technologies of fault-tolerance for safety-critical applications have received great attentions and kinds of fault-tolerant rotating machines have been developed with multi-phase, fractional slot concentrated winding and fault-tolerant teeth. The main objective of this special issue is to collect the ideas of the worldwide researchers and present the latest progresses and developments in design, modeling, and control of rotating machines with cost reduction or reliability improvement. Topics of interest of this special session include, but are not limited to: • Electric machines with hybrid excitation • Permanent magnet assisted synchronous reluctance machines • Non rare earth permanent magnet machines • Fault-tolerant electric machines • Novel modeling and analysis methods of permanent magnet machines with cost reduction or reliability improvement • Novel fault-tolerant control strategies for fault-tolerant permanent magnet machines • Applications of permanent magnet machines with cost reduction or reliability improvement Manuscript Due June 09, 2017 First Round of Reviews September 01, 2017 Publication Date October 27, 2017 https://www.hindawi.com/journals/ijrm/ |
